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3310 89562505 07228091 59
943475909 3669 82837709
943475909 3669 82837709
860687 426 1761036397
All about undefined
Interested in learning more?
943475909 3669 82837709
860687 426 1761036397
See more
2493 03846 6465277
4967075799 00741429 93
See more
6598877374 49323762643 4502
261 58346843362 32
See more